IBC - Liquidation Process - Certain provisions of the regulation ...

Insolvency and Bankruptcy

April 30, 2022

IBC - Liquidation Process - Certain provisions of the regulation shall apply to the liquidation processes commencing on or after the date of the commencement of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Board of India (Liquidation Process) (Amendment) Regulations, 2019 - whereas the liquidation process has commenced earlier, old provisions shall apply.
